Warum Sie die .htaccess-Datei auf Ihrer WordPress-Seite nicht

9 hours ago, Beginners Guide, Views
Warum Sie die .htaccess-Datei auf Ihrer WordPress-Seite nicht

Warum Sie die .htaccess-Datei auf Ihrer WordPress-Seite in Deutschland nicht direkt bearbeiten sollten

Die .htaccess-Datei ist ein mächtiges Werkzeug, das die Funktionsweise Ihres Apache-Webservers beeinflussen kann. Sie ermöglicht die Konfiguration von Weiterleitungen, die Steuerung des Caches und die Verbesserung der Sicherheit. Insbesondere auf WordPress-Seiten ist sie von Bedeutung. In Deutschland ist jedoch Vorsicht geboten, wenn es darum geht, diese Datei direkt zu bearbeiten. Es gibt bessere Alternativen, die weniger riskant sind und sicherer in die WordPress-Umgebung integrieren lassen.

Die Bedeutung der .htaccess-Datei für WordPress

Die .htaccess-Datei liegt im Stammverzeichnis Ihrer WordPress-Installation und beeinflusst, wie Apache, der am weitesten verbreitete Webserver, Ihre Website behandelt. Sie wird verwendet, um:

  • Permalinks zu konfigurieren
  • Weiterleitungen zu erstellen
  • Den Zugriff auf bestimmte Dateien oder Verzeichnisse zu steuern
  • Die Caching-Einstellungen anzupassen
  • Die Sicherheit zu erhöhen, beispielsweise durch das Blockieren bestimmter IP-Adressen

Eine korrekt konfigurierte .htaccess-Datei kann die Performance Ihrer Website verbessern, die Suchmaschinenoptimierung (SEO) unterstützen und die Sicherheit erhöhen. Fehlerhafte Konfigurationen hingegen können zu Fehlermeldungen, Performance-Problemen oder sogar zur Unzugänglichkeit Ihrer Website führen.

Die Risiken der direkten Bearbeitung der .htaccess-Datei

Obwohl die .htaccess-Datei mächtig ist, birgt die direkte Bearbeitung einige Risiken, insbesondere für Nutzer in Deutschland, wo die Gesetzeslage und Anforderungen an Datenschutz und Datensicherheit streng sind:

Syntaxfehler

Die .htaccess-Datei verwendet eine spezielle Syntax. Ein einziger Tippfehler oder ein falsch platzierter Befehl kann dazu führen, dass Ihre Website nicht mehr erreichbar ist. Apache wird dann eine Fehlermeldung (z.B. einen 500 Internal Server Error) anzeigen.

Inkompatibilität mit Plugins

Viele WordPress-Plugins greifen auf die .htaccess-Datei zu, um ihre Funktionen zu implementieren. Direkte Änderungen können zu Konflikten mit diesen Plugins führen und deren Funktionalität beeinträchtigen. Dies kann insbesondere bei Sicherheits- und Caching-Plugins kritisch sein.

Überschreiben durch WordPress

WordPress selbst kann die .htaccess-Datei bei bestimmten Aktionen überschreiben, beispielsweise beim Ändern der Permalink-Struktur. Direkte Änderungen können dadurch verloren gehen.

Datenschutzrechtliche Aspekte in Deutschland

In Deutschland ist der Datenschutz ein sensibles Thema. Die .htaccess-Datei kann verwendet werden, um den Zugriff auf bestimmte Dateien zu protokollieren oder Benutzer zu identifizieren. Unsachgemäße Konfigurationen können gegen die Datenschutzgrundverordnung (DSGVO) verstoßen und rechtliche Konsequenzen haben. Beispielsweise kann das Logging von IP-Adressen ohne Zustimmung des Nutzers problematisch sein.

Sicherheitsrisiken

Eine falsch konfigurierte .htaccess-Datei kann Sicherheitslücken öffnen. Beispielsweise kann sie Angreifern ermöglichen, auf sensible Dateien zuzugreifen oder Schadcode einzuschleusen. Gerade in Deutschland, wo Unternehmen verstärkt Ziel von Cyberangriffen sind, ist dies ein relevantes Risiko.

Bessere Alternativen zur direkten Bearbeitung der .htaccess-Datei

Glücklicherweise gibt es sicherere und benutzerfreundlichere Alternativen zur direkten Bearbeitung der .htaccess-Datei:

WordPress-Plugins

Es gibt zahlreiche WordPress-Plugins, die speziell für die Verwaltung von .htaccess-Funktionen entwickelt wurden. Diese Plugins bieten in der Regel eine grafische Benutzeroberfläche, die die Konfiguration vereinfacht und das Risiko von Syntaxfehlern reduziert. Sie sind auch oft mit anderen Plugins kompatibel und berücksichtigen die spezifischen Anforderungen von WordPress.

Beispiele für solche Plugins sind:

  • Yoast SEO (für Permalink-Verwaltung)
  • W3 Total Cache (für Caching)
  • Wordfence (für Sicherheitsfunktionen)

Diese Plugins bieten oft eine intuitive Benutzeroberfläche, die es auch weniger erfahrenen Benutzern ermöglicht, komplexe Konfigurationen vorzunehmen, ohne direkt mit der .htaccess-Datei interagieren zu müssen. Zudem sorgen sie oft für die automatische Einhaltung wichtiger Best Practices, auch im Hinblick auf Datenschutz.

Die WordPress-Admin-Oberfläche

Für grundlegende Konfigurationen, wie das Ändern der Permalink-Struktur, bietet WordPress selbst Optionen in der Admin-Oberfläche. Diese Änderungen werden dann automatisch in der .htaccess-Datei vorgenommen, ohne dass Sie diese direkt bearbeiten müssen.

Verwaltung über das Hosting-Panel

Viele Hosting-Anbieter bieten Tools in ihren Control Panels (z.B. cPanel, Plesk) an, die die Verwaltung von .htaccess-Funktionen vereinfachen. Diese Tools bieten oft eine grafische Oberfläche für die Erstellung von Weiterleitungen, die Konfiguration von Caching und die Steuerung des Zugriffs.

Professionelle Unterstützung

Wenn Sie unsicher sind, wie Sie die .htaccess-Datei konfigurieren sollen oder spezifische Anforderungen haben, die über die Möglichkeiten von Plugins hinausgehen, ist es ratsam, professionelle Unterstützung in Anspruch zu nehmen. Ein erfahrener WordPress-Entwickler oder Systemadministrator kann die notwendigen Änderungen vornehmen und sicherstellen, dass Ihre Website optimal konfiguriert ist und alle rechtlichen Anforderungen erfüllt.

Spezifische Empfehlungen für Deutschland

Neben den allgemeinen Risiken der direkten Bearbeitung der .htaccess-Datei gibt es in Deutschland einige spezifische Aspekte zu beachten:

DSGVO-Konformität

Stellen Sie sicher, dass alle Änderungen, die Sie an der .htaccess-Datei vornehmen, mit der DSGVO übereinstimmen. Vermeiden Sie das Logging von IP-Adressen ohne Zustimmung des Nutzers und implementieren Sie geeignete Maßnahmen zum Schutz personenbezogener Daten.

Impressumspflicht

Die .htaccess-Datei kann verwendet werden, um den Zugriff auf bestimmte Dateien zu steuern. Stellen Sie sicher, dass Ihr Impressum jederzeit zugänglich ist und nicht versehentlich durch restriktive Konfigurationen blockiert wird.

Abmahngefahr

Deutschland ist bekannt für seine strenge Abmahnkultur. Achten Sie darauf, dass Ihre Website keine Urheberrechte verletzt und alle rechtlichen Anforderungen erfüllt. Eine falsch konfigurierte .htaccess-Datei kann unbeabsichtigt zu Rechtsverstößen führen.

  • Überprüfen Sie regelmäßig Ihre .htaccess-Datei auf mögliche Sicherheitslücken.
  • Verwenden Sie Plugins, die speziell für die Einhaltung der DSGVO entwickelt wurden.
  • Lassen Sie Ihre Website von einem Experten auf rechtliche Konformität überprüfen.

Best Practices für die Verwendung der .htaccess-Datei (auch indirekt)

Auch wenn Sie die .htaccess-Datei nicht direkt bearbeiten, sollten Sie einige Best Practices beachten:

Regelmäßige Backups

Erstellen Sie regelmäßig Backups Ihrer .htaccess-Datei, bevor Sie Änderungen vornehmen. So können Sie im Falle eines Fehlers schnell zur vorherigen Version zurückkehren.

Dokumentation

Dokumentieren Sie alle Änderungen, die Sie an der .htaccess-Datei vornehmen. Dies erleichtert die Fehlersuche und die Zusammenarbeit mit anderen Entwicklern.

Testumgebung

Testen Sie alle Änderungen in einer Testumgebung, bevor Sie sie auf Ihrer Live-Website implementieren. So können Sie sicherstellen, dass keine unerwarteten Probleme auftreten.

  • Erstellen Sie vor jeder Änderung ein Backup der .htaccess-Datei.
  • Verwenden Sie einen Texteditor mit Syntaxhervorhebung, um Fehler zu vermeiden.
  • Testen Sie die Änderungen in einer Staging-Umgebung, bevor Sie sie auf die Live-Website übertragen.

Fazit

Die .htaccess-Datei ist ein mächtiges Werkzeug, das jedoch mit Vorsicht zu genießen ist. Insbesondere in Deutschland, wo Datenschutz und Rechtssicherheit eine große Rolle spielen, ist es ratsam, die direkte Bearbeitung der .htaccess-Datei zu vermeiden und stattdessen auf sicherere und benutzerfreundlichere Alternativen zu setzen. WordPress-Plugins, die Admin-Oberfläche und die Tools Ihres Hosting-Anbieters bieten in der Regel ausreichend Möglichkeiten, um die gewünschten Konfigurationen vorzunehmen, ohne das Risiko einzugehen, Ihre Website zu beschädigen oder gegen rechtliche Bestimmungen zu verstoßen. Sollten Sie dennoch unsicher sein, scheuen Sie sich nicht, professionelle Unterstützung in Anspruch zu nehmen. So stellen Sie sicher, dass Ihre WordPress-Seite optimal konfiguriert ist und alle rechtlichen Anforderungen erfüllt.

  • Vermeiden Sie die direkte Bearbeitung der .htaccess-Datei.
  • Nutzen Sie WordPress-Plugins und die Admin-Oberfläche für Konfigurationen.
  • Achten Sie auf die Einhaltung der DSGVO und anderer rechtlicher Bestimmungen.